Delivery has become an increasingly important part of modern business as modern consumers have an increased desire for convenience in the orders they place. One benefit of this is that when you do your own deliveries, you can use the delivery vehicles as an advertising opportunity while they perform their delivery duties. In order to make this as effective as possible, you must have delivery vehicles that are easy to recognize and that support your brand in a positive way.
Use the Same Vehicles
The first goal you want to attain is to make sure that your entire fleet of vehicles is consistent in their makes and models. This will help to create a cohesive brand image and start to build a connection between your business and the type of cars your fleet is made up of. This will make it easier for current and potential customers to recognize your vehicles and have your business on their minds when they see cars of a similar make and model. It’s important that you choose a make and model of vehicle that is dependable and has a good reputation so you can continue showing your business in the best light.
Brand Them With Your Logo
The next step is to make sure that your fleet is designed to be consistent with your branding. This means that all vehicles in your fleet should be branded with your logo. The best way to do this is through vehicle wraps, since they are a good and dependable way to apply branding to your vehicles. In addition, vehicle wraps are cheaper than painting your entire fleet. Wraps are generally easy to place and can last at least 2 years.
Stay on Top of Maintenance
You want your fleet to look its best at all times as this will help to increase recognition and improve your reputation. To do this, you must make sure that you are always on top of maintenance for your vehicles. In addition to helping the appearance of your fleet and business, this will also help you to save money over time since you will be able to avoid many issues and catch others as early as possible.
Your delivery fleet of vehicles can do a lot of work for your business. In addition to moving cargo, they can become an important part of your branding. So let your fleet work for you and make sure that you give it the time, funding and attention it needs to be successful.
